Output d50866b4365e523bfe9f9af32651e11ea147b3bddc0abf27297db5503f6913ce:1

value
21163856
script pubkey
OP_0 OP_PUSHBYTES_20 43609a415507d4a134c615fef650acdc37cab9a6
address
ltc1qgdsf5s24ql22zdxxzhl0v59vmsmu4wdxegt5cu
transaction
d50866b4365e523bfe9f9af32651e11ea147b3bddc0abf27297db5503f6913ce
spent
true